Tropical Slush

This Tropical Slush with lime, coconut, and pineapple flavors is the perfect thirst-quencher for a hot summer day. Fancy it up by serving in hollowed pineapples with a cherry on top!

Ingredients

  • 1/2 gallon lime sherbet
  • 1/2 gallon pineapple sherbet
  • 2 liters 7-up
  • 6 ounces frozen pineapple juice
  • 6 ounces frozen limeade
  • 7 1/2 ounces Coco Lopez Cream of Coconut

Garnishes (optional)

Instructions

  • Allow sherbets to soften slightly.
  • Mash sherbets, frozen juices, 7-up, and cream of coconut together.
  • Serve in cups or hollowed out pineapples.

Notes

*This recipe makes approximately 15 12-ounce servings (1 1/2 cups) or 22 8-ounce servings (1 cup).
